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

01. DADOS GERAIS

Produto:

TOTVS Saúde Planos

Linha de Produto:

Datasul

Segmento:

Saúde

Módulo:

HAT - Atendimento ao Público

HRC - Revisão de Contas Médicas

Função:

Portal do Prestador 

Autorizador Web

Importa/Processa XML Lote Guias (hrc.importProcessTissGuideBatch)

Exportação Mvimentos para Cobrança (hrc0510m)

TISSCancelaGuia

TISSComunicacaoBeneficiario

TISSLoteAnexo

TISSSolicitacaoProcedimento

TISSSolicitacaoStatusAutorizacao

TISSVerificaElegibilidade

País:Brasil
Requisito:

DSAUGPSCONTAS-27591

DSAUGPSCONTAS-27631

DSAUGPSAUTOR-20767

02. SITUAÇÃO/REQUISITO

...

Adequações das alterações da versão TISS 4.02.00.

...

Início de Vigência em 01/06/2025 e limite de implantação em 30/11/2025.

03. SOLUÇÃO

As alterações visam compatibilizar o módulo os módulos Revisão de Contas e Atendimento ao Público do TOTVS Saúde Planos - Linha Datasul as alterações da TISS 4.02.00

...

conf1,conf2,conf3
Totvs custom tabs box
tabsProcedimento para Configuração,Procedimento para Utilização
idspasso2,passo3
Totvs custom tabs box items
defaultyes
referenciapasso2
Totvs custom tabs box
Adequações Atendimento ao Público, Adequações Revisão de Contas, Tabelas de domínio TISS 4.02.00, Lote Guias, Monitoramento TISS
idsatendimento,contas,tabelas,loteguias,monitoramento
tabsServidor de Aplicação,Broker Escalável,Autenticação
ids
conf1
  • a parametrização da propriedade com.totvs.saude.tiss.version do Autorizador Web com o valor 4.02.00

Para que a comunicação funcione corretamente, é necessário que o Tomcat onde é executado o serviço totvs-hgp-tiss-webservices-40200.war reconheça as variáveis abaixo. A configuração pode ser feita diretamente nos scripts de inicialização do Tomcat (mais detalhes e exemplos aqui: Como criar variaveis de ambiente visiveis ao Datasul no Tomcat) ou mesmo diretamente como variáveis de ambiente do sistema operacional:

TOTVS_HOST: <host>:<porta> do serviço do Tomcat do Datasul. Ex: http://meu-datasul:8080

TOTVS_USERNAME: usuário de login que será utilizado para autenticação Basic no Datasul para execução dos serviços

TOTVS_PASSWORD: senha que será utilizada junto ao parâmetro acima

Obs: estas variáveis são utilizadas por outras aplicações, portanto é possível que já estejam configuradas no seu ambiente, e nesse caso, nenhuma ação é necessária, apenas a conferência.

  • :


Image Added


  • Para Portal Prestador é necessário parametrizar a Versão TISS Configurações do Portal Prestador (hac.portPrestConfig) com 4.02.00:


Image Added


Totvs custom tabs box items
defaultyes
referencia
atendimento
  • Com
o novo serviço, a aplicação htzfoundation.ear (JBoss) passa a ser dividida em um artefato distinto no Tomcat, contendo somente os Webservices TISS conforme a versão:
Informações
Versão TISSArtefato
totvs-hgp-tiss-webservices-40200.war
Informações
titleDica para validar esta etapa
Aviso

O Autorizador Web e Portal e Prestador devem ser parametrizados para nova versão juntos.

É necessário que seja parametrizado no programa Manutenção Parâmetros Revisão de Contas (hrc.paramrc) a versão da TISS para que sejam compatíveis na hora de comunicar, sem ocorrer falhas. 


Image Added

Após configurar as variáveis de ambiente e reiniciar o Tomcat, utilize a URL abaixo para validar se o ambiente as reconheceu corretamente:

http://<SERVIDOR>:<PORTA>/totvs-hgp-webservices/ptu/v8/integrations/gateway/serverInfo

O resultado deve ser semelhante a isto:

Image Removed

As variáveis precisam aparecer nesta consulta antes de prosseguir para a próxima etapa. Caso contrário ocorrerão problemas de comunicação.


O novo serviço utiliza o conceito de Broker Escalável, onde é possível direcionar as chamadas ao Progress para um broker específico, isolando o back-end de outras aplicações, como o ERP por exemplo.

Toda comunicação encaminhada da aplicação totvs-hgp-tiss-webservices-40200.war para o Progress enviará na requisição a chave "x-totvs-server-alias" como "totvs-saude-planos-tiss-webservices", sendo necessário que o cliente inclua através do Empresas do Foundation (html.companies) um novo registro contendo esse alias.

Exemplo:
No programa html.companies (Empresas do Foundation), criar um novo registro nos Cadastros relacionados → Servidores de aplicação, contendo o alias "totvs-saude-planos-tiss-webservices": 

Image Removed

Totvs custom tabs box items
defaultno
referenciacontas
  1. Executar o SPP para que seja trocada a versão da TISS para 4.02.00
    1. tiss\spp\sp_atualiza_versao_4_02_00.p

  2. No TOTVS12, acesse o programa Manutenção Layout (hte.layout) e realize a importação do arquivo database\dados\tablas.d utilizando a opção Importar para efetuar a inclusão do novo layout.
    1. Programas de layout que serão criados:
      1. LATISS-E40200 - LAYOUT DE EXPORTACAO TISS - 4.02.00
      2. Image Added
conf2
Aviso

Caso o cliente deseje isolar a parte Progress dos Webservices TISS em um broker separado, deve ser criada uma nova instância do PASOE, referenciando-a através do campo "Servidor Aplicação". Para maiores detalhes sobre a criação da instância no PASOE, ver a documentação: Criando uma instância PASOE através do OpenEdge Explorer

Caso o cliente não deseje fazer essa separação, basta criar o registro com o alias "totvs-saude-planos-tiss-webservices" referenciando para o mesmo "Servidor Aplicação" existente.

Na página Broker Escalável - Exemplo de como fazer uso do aplicativo e alias para chamadas REST é possível verificar maiores detalhes sobre essa configuração.


Para integrar com o novo serviço, deve ser realizada a autenticação do prestador na própria mensagem, conforme previsto pelo manual da TISS:

Image Removed

Exemplo de preenchimento no XML:

Image Removed

A habilitação do prestador ocorre através do cadastro Manutenção de Usuários Portal do Prestador (hat.secretary).

  • O campo loginPrestador a ser informado no XML será o Usuário informado nesse cadastro
  • O campo senhaPrestador a ser informado no XML será a Senha informada nesse cadastro, em formato MD5

Na aba Prestadores Associados deve haver o vínculo do prestador informado na tag "codigoPrestadorNaOperadora" com o papel de Serviço:

Image Removed

Caso o papel esteja como Padrão, o Status como Inativo, o vínculo com o prestador não exista ou a senha não corresponda, o usuário não terá permissão para integrar com o serviço, sendo retornada a mensagem:

  • Falha na autenticação. Usuário ou senha incorretos ou o usuário informado não tem permissão para utilizar esse serviço nesse prestador e/ou versão da TISS
    • Exemplo:

Image Removed

Totvs custom tabs box items
defaultno
referencia
conf3
tabelas

    

  • Terminologia de Classificação Brasileira de Ocupações (CBO) - Tabela 24

           Adicionado CBO novo 223575 Obstetriz na listagem de CBOs.

Image Added


  • Terminologia de status da guia e do protocolo - Tabela 47

Image Added


  • Terminologia da versão do componente de comunicação do padrão - Tabela 69 Image Added


http://
    • <serv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/loteGuias

Para validar se um endpoint está no ar, pode ser acessado o endereço via navegador, acrescido de ".wsdl".

Image Removed

Um prestador pode consumir ambos serviços simultaneamente .

Exemplo: Para Solicitação de Procedimentos, integrar com o endpoint antigo e para o Cancelamento de Guia, integrar com o endpoint novo.

Essa abordagem permite à Operadora realizar a homologação/migração de forma parcial, por prestador e por mensagem.
    • )


Totvs custom tabs box items
defaultno
referenciapasso3loteguias
  • O Foundation Saúde está preparado para receber arquivos XML na versões 4.02.00 da TISS: 

    1. Manualmente
      1. Na tela Upload XML, selecione o arquivo com uma das novas versões;
      2. Clique em Upload;
      3. O sistema irá importar o arquivo;

    2. Por meio dos web services, cujos endereços podem ser consultados por meio da página de serviços do JBOSS (Ex: http://enderecoDoFoundation:<porta>/jbossws/services):
      • TISSSolicitacaoStatusAutorizacaoV_4_02_00WS;

      • TISSSolicitacaoProcedimentoV_4_02_00WS;

      • TISSComunicacaoBeneficiarioV_4_02_00WS;

      • TISSVerificaElegibilidadeV_4_02_00WS;

      • TISSCancelaGuiaV_4_02_00WS;

      • TISSSolicitacaoStatusRecursoGlosaV_4_02_00WS;

      • TISSSolicitacaoStatusProtocoloV_4_02_00WS;

      • TISSLoteAnexoV_4_02_00WS;

      • TISSRecursoGlosaV_4_02_00WS;

      • TISSLoteGuiasV_4_02_00WS;

      • TISSSolicitacaoDemonstrativoRetornoV_4_02_00WS;

  • Webservices TISS:
    • TOMCAT (Lote Guias: http://

Não houve alteração no processo de utilização das funcionalidades que envolvem os Webservices TISS. Todas as regras de negócio (incluindo CPC's) foram mantidas.

O que irá diferenciar os serviços será o endpoint com que o prestador realizará a integração de cada mensagem, conforme destacado a seguir:

Aviso

É necessário substituir o <servidor> e <porta> conforme seu ambiente e a <versao> conforme a TISS (40100 para 4.01.00 ou 40001 para 4.00.01).

Exemplo comparativo de endpoints da TISS 4.02.00:

Mensagem TISSEndpoint antigo (JBoss)Endpoint novo (Tomcat)
Solicitação Demonstrativo de Retornohtt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SSolicitacaoDemonstrativoRetornoV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/solicitacaoDemonstrativoRetorno
Solicitação Status Protocolohtt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SSolicitacaoStatusProtocoloV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/solicitacaoStatusProtocolo
Solicitação Status de Autorizaçãohtt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SSolicitacaoStatusAutorizacaoV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/solicitaçãoStatusAutorizacao
Solicitação Procedimentohtt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SSolicitacaoProcedimentoV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/solicitacaoProcedimento
Solicitação Status  Recurso Glosahtt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SSolicitacaoStatusRecursoGlosaV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/solicitaçãoStatusRecursoGlosa
Cancela Guiahtt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SCancelaGuiaV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/cancelaGuia
Verifica Elegibilidadehtt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SVerificaElegibilidadeV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/pedidoElegibilidade
Comunicação Beneficiáriohtt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SComunicacaoBeneficiarioV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/comunicacaoBeneficiario
Envio de Documentoshtt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SEnvioDocumentosV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/envioDocumentos
Recurso Glosahttp://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SRecursoGlosaV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/recursoGlosa

Lote Anexo

http://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SLoteAnexoV_4_02_00WShttp://<servidor>:<porta>/totvs-hgp-tiss-webservices-40200/api/loteAnexo

Lote Guias

http://<servidor>:<porta>/htzfoundation-HTZFoundationEJB/TISSLoteGuiasV_4_02_00WS
Informações
titleDica
Totvs custom tabs box items
defaultno
referenciamonitoramento


04. ASSUNTOS RELACIONADOS

DT TISS 4.02.00 (Tomcat)



Templatedocumentos